Output eab3776ee51310a39fb913b1c25767bfde83ae15c00fd5e7eb38b12c9e356240:5

value
34861609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f438277fe4b6c0890c31c48b4b9156122d0ef4 OP_EQUAL
address
MG1WFyBDofRHPEbrD3JK2zuPJsYdUCq7AD
transaction
eab3776ee51310a39fb913b1c25767bfde83ae15c00fd5e7eb38b12c9e356240
spent
true